How to Extend the Life of Your Motorsport Engine

Regularly check oil levels and quality; this practice is crucial for optimal lubrication. Synthetic oils are often preferred for their superior properties in high-stress conditions. Ensure that the correct viscosity is used to match ambient temperature and driving style.

Monitor coolant systems diligently. Overheating can lead to catastrophic failures, so inspect hoses, radiator, and coolant levels regularly. Consider upgrading to a more efficient radiator for improved heat dissipation during rigorous activities.

Scheduled inspections of mechanical components can prevent costly breakdowns. Pay special attention to belts, hoses, and electrical connections, which can wear out faster under the strain of competition. Replacing these parts proactively can save time and effort in the long run.

Investing in quality fuel greatly influences performance and durability. Use high-octane fuel and consider additives that enhance combustion efficiency. Avoid fuel with high ethanol content, as it may cause detrimental effects on seals and gaskets.

Lastly, maintain a meticulous cleaning routine for both the exterior and interior of the mechanical setup. Dirt and debris can lead to overheating and reduced performance. A clean environment aids not just in performance but also extends the life of components significantly.

Regular Oil Change Schedule and Filter Maintenance

Establish an oil change routine every 3,000 to 5,000 miles, depending on usage and type of lubricant. Frequent use in competitive settings may necessitate more frequent changes.

Always opt for high-performance oil that meets specific viscosity requirements for peak operation. Synthetic oil often provides better protection under extreme conditions.

Inspect and replace the oil filter each time you change the lubricant. A clean filter maintains proper oil flow and prevents contaminants from circulating in the system.

Monitor oil quality through regular checks, noting color, consistency, and levels. Dark, gritty oil indicates it’s time for a change.

Utilize an oil pressure gauge as a diagnostic tool. Consistent pressure levels ensure adequate lubrication and signal any underlying problems early.

Maintain records of all maintenance to track changes, which can help predict future needs and optimize care.

Monitoring Engine Temperature and Cooling System Checks

Regularly monitor the temperature gauge during operation. Keep it within the manufacturer’s recommended range to prevent overheating. Use an accurate aftermarket gauge for precise readings if necessary.

Check the coolant levels frequently. Ensure that the coolant reservoir is filled appropriately to maintain optimal performance. Low coolant levels can lead to rapid overheating and significant damage.

Inspect the radiator and hoses for leaks, cracks, or blockages. Address any issues immediately to avoid coolant loss and potential catastrophic failures.

Flushing the cooling system periodically helps remove dirt and debris that can hinder performance. Follow the manufacturer’s schedule for this maintenance task. Use the proper coolant mixture for your specific application to ensure effective heat transfer.

Monitor the condition of your water pump. Listen for strange noises that might indicate wear. Replace it as needed to maintain an effective cooling cycle.

Check the thermostat function by testing it in boiling water to see if it opens at the specified temperature. A malfunctioning thermostat can disrupt the cooling system’s efficiency.

After every session, inspect all components of the cooling system. Early detection of issues can save time and money, ensuring a reliable sports vehicle for future races.

Using Quality Fuel and Engine Additives for Enhanced Performance

Select high-octane fuel to maximize combustion efficiency and power output. This type of fuel minimizes knocking and ensures smoother operation. Regularly fill up at reputable stations to avoid impurities that can harm the combustion chamber and injectors.

Additives can significantly enhance performance and care. Look for detergents in fuel that help keep the injectors clean, preventing deposits that can hinder fuel flow. Additionally, using an oil antioxidant additive can reduce wear and tear on internal components, promoting longevity.

A periodic octane booster can be beneficial, especially before competitive events, providing a temporary increase in performance. However, ensure that any additives used are compatible with the specific configuration of the setup to avoid detrimental reactions.

Check the manufacturer’s recommendations regarding fuel types and additives, ensuring that maintenance routines incorporate these products. Regular monitoring of the fuel system will highlight any potential issues early and improve reliability.
